Stainless steel etching is a process that involves the use of acid or a chemical solution to create intricate designs, patterns, or markings on stainless steel surfaces. This technique is commonly used in industries such as aerospace, automotive, electronics, and jewelry, where precision and durability are essential.

The process of stainless steel etching begins with the preparation of the metal surface. The stainless steel sheet or plate is thoroughly cleaned to remove any contaminants, such as rust, dirt, or oil, that may interfere with the etching process. Once the surface is clean, a protective mask or stencil is applied to the areas that will not be etched. This mask is typically made of a durable material, such as vinyl or rubber, that can withstand exposure to the etching solution.

Next, the stainless steel sheet is placed in a tank or container filled with the etching solution. The most common etching solution used for stainless steel is ferric chloride, which is a powerful acid that can efficiently etch the metal surface. The etching solution selectively corrodes the exposed areas of the stainless steel, creating a contrast between the etched and non-etched areas.

The etching process can be controlled by adjusting the temperature, concentration, and duration of exposure to the etching solution. Different etching techniques, such as immersion etching, spray etching, or electrochemical etching, can be used to achieve different results and effects. Immersion etching is the most common method, where the stainless steel sheet is completely submerged in the etching solution for a specific period of time.

One of the key advantages of stainless steel etching is its ability to create precise and intricate designs with high accuracy and repeatability. Unlike traditional methods such as stamping or engraving, etching does not require physical contact with the metal surface, minimizing the risk of damage or distortion. This makes stainless steel etching ideal for producing fine details, deep engravings, or complex patterns that may be challenging to achieve with other techniques.

Stainless steel etching is also a versatile and cost-effective process that can be used to etch a wide range of stainless steel grades, thicknesses, and surface finishes. Whether it is a polished, brushed, or textured surface, the etching process can be tailored to achieve the desired result while preserving the integrity and aesthetics of the stainless steel.

In addition to creating decorative elements or branding logos, stainless steel etching is also used for functional purposes, such as marking serial numbers, barcodes, or safety warnings on stainless steel components. The etched markings are permanent and indelible, making them resistant to wear, fading, or tampering, which is crucial for applications where traceability and durability are essential.

stainless steel etchers, also known as etching machines or acid etchers, are specialized equipment used to automate and streamline the etching process. These machines are designed to control the etching parameters, such as acid concentration, temperature, and agitation, to ensure consistent and uniform results. stainless steel etchers can be customized with features such as CNC control, high-resolution cameras, or robotic arms to enhance precision and productivity.

When choosing a stainless steel etcher, it is essential to consider factors such as the size and thickness of the stainless steel sheets, the complexity of the designs, and the production volume. Small-scale etching projects may benefit from manual etching methods, such as hand-held etching pens or stencils, which offer flexibility and cost-effectiveness. On the other hand, large-scale production runs may require automated etching machines with high throughput and accuracy to meet strict quality standards and timelines.
